driver problem/registry question

Expand Post »
I've been having a driver problem with my CD and DVD burners on 2 computers. Someone suggested I remove the following keys from the registry:

There are 2 reg keys that can screw the device......remove them both and reboot......

The keys are:

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Class\{4D36E965-E325 -11CE-BFC1-08002BE10318} - "Upperfilters" and "Lowerfilters".

but my question is do I remove the entire line: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Class\{4D36E965-E325 -11CE-BFC1-08002BE10318}? or do I just delete the "Upperfilters and "Lowerfilters" from the right column??? I know it's a dumb question, but I hate messing with the registry.

Please help!
Thanks

Re: driver problem/registry question

just delete the upper and lower filters from the right column
